I need to publish an internal LAN machine over Internet and I'm doing it via NAT. I made translation rules, ARPed and manually routed the addresses and put everything on. Now everything works fine (I'm able to extablish connections on SSH, SMTP,FTP and POP3), but as soon as I try to establish a connection on HTTP (port 80) I see that my packets go dropped by FW1 with an error on "infamous" rule0 (it says local interface address spoofing) between my Gateway and Public IP. What should do ?
